Who Votes In The Undie Awards?
June 15, 2009
When people vote, they first select the body types that most closely define their shape. Specifically, we ask voters to select a bust type, a tummy type and a bottom type. Each year, we are surprised by how consistently the percentages break out among body types regardless of the increase in votes.
The 2009 Undie Award voters are as follows:
20% Small Bust
28% Average Bust
8% Augmented Bust
31% Full Bust
13% Plus Size Bust
52% claim to have little or no tummy
11% claim to have no bottom
8% claim to have a low hanging bottom
11% claim to have a bubble bottom.
For the men, 36% were 6 feet or taller.
Finally, 21% of our voters were in their teens or 20′s; 47% were in their 30′s or 40′s; 33% were in their 50′s or older.

The 2009 Undie Award Winners
June 09, 2009
Your votes are in! This year we received more than 20,000 votes from women and men telling us their favorite undergarments. Some are repeats from last year, but there are also some fresh new designs. So, for the third year in a row, here are the 2009 Undie Awards Winners:
This year’s Overall bra winner for average figure goes to the Vanity Fair Body Sleeks Contour Stretch Bra 75-266. This is the second year in a row that this bra has won this award. Bottom line: this bra is just plain comfortable with a very simple t-shirt design.
This year’s Overall bra winner for full figure goes to the Panache Superbra Tango Underwire Balconnet bra 3251. A pretty and flattering bra, it is also very supportive. Its cup sizing goes up to a JJ.
The Overall Panty winner was the Olga Secret Hug Nylon Scoop Halfpant 913. Over the three years of this award, most of the panty winners have had a center back seam. This center back seam gives a much better fit and shape while keeping the panty from riding up.
In the Men’s category, the Overall Favorite Boxers went to Calvin Klein Slim Fit Woven Boxer U1513 for the Woven category, and the Calvin Klein Cotton Knit Boxer U3008 for the knit category. Both have a devoted following because neither has too much or too little fabric. Both fit just right.
In total, there are 36 Undie Awards given out in the Woman’s category, and 14 Undie Awards given out in the Men’s category.
